Author

Faiz Paracha

Faiz Paracha, an esteemed broadcast journalist with over two decades of experience, excels in reporting and editorial positions. His expertise lies in the economy and energy sectors, where he has delivered thorough coverage and valuable insights.

Currently serving as the Head of Reporting at News Diplomacy, Faiz manages coverage related to diplomatic missions, international development organizations, the United Nations, and foreign affairs. His diverse interests encompass environmental and climatic issues, alongside his profound knowledge of business, economy, and energy.
